Why Pre-Mixed Pellets
Most hardwood mushroom pellets on the market are plain sawdust. You have to source wheat bran separately, measure precise ratios, and blend everything yourself, adding time and room for error. Our pellets arrive pre-blended to the professional 80/20 ratio that commercial farms rely on. The hardwood sawdust provides the carbon-rich base your mycelium colonizes, while the organic wheat bran supplies the nitrogen supplement that drives vigorous growth and heavy fruiting. Open the bag, hydrate, and you are ready to sterilize.
How to Use
Hydrate
Measure out 2 lbs of pellets per 5 lb finished block. Add water to reach 60% moisture content. The pellets will break down into a fluffy, supplemented sawdust substrate within minutes.
Bag and sterilize
Load the hydrated substrate into autoclavable mushroom grow bags. Sterilize in a pressure cooker or autoclave at 15 PSI for 2.5 hours.
Cool and inoculate
Allow bags to cool completely (8-12 hours). Working in clean conditions, add your grain spawn or liquid culture, mix thoroughly, and seal.
Incubate and fruit
Store sealed bags at 20-24 C until fully colonized (2-4 weeks). Then move to fruiting conditions with 80-90% humidity and fresh air exchange.
Compatible Species
- Oyster mushrooms (all varieties)
- Lion's mane
- Chestnut mushrooms
- Shiitake
- Maitake, reishi, turkey tail
- King oyster, black poplar, and other wood-loving species
